軟件開發(fā)外包好不好(開發(fā)軟件的外包公司有哪些)
本篇文章給大家談談軟件開發(fā)外包好不好,以及開發(fā)軟件的外包公司有哪些對應的知識點,希望對各位有所幫助,不要忘了收藏本站喔。
本文目錄一覽:
軟件項目外包指什么?有什么好處?
#?軟件項目外包?#
軟件項目外包是企業(yè)將軟件項目外包給提供外包服務的企業(yè)完成的軟件需求活動。
在明確的項目目標、時間要求、交付標準等基礎上,軟件開發(fā)公司和需求企業(yè)簽訂軟件開發(fā)合同,需求企業(yè)按照約定時間或開發(fā)節(jié)點付款,軟件外包公司負責設計產品原型、UI、開發(fā)、測試、上線等工作。
軟件項目外包的好處很直接,就是省錢省心省力,需求企業(yè)基本只用操心前期溝通問題,不用費時費力去管理和安排工作,項目開發(fā)的全生命周期由軟件外包公司提供一條龍服務。
軟件外包公司內部的技術人員更多且更專業(yè),具有豐富的項目經(jīng)驗與成熟的技術,即使遇到問題也能馬上召開專家會議討論解決方案,這樣開發(fā)出來的軟件才能更好的滿足企業(yè)的需求,也更加節(jié)省時間。
在項目交付完成和投入運營之后,需求企業(yè)還可以繼續(xù)委托軟件外包公司進行項目的維護和迭代升級,為需求企業(yè)提供了極大的便利性。
APP開發(fā)外包好還是自己做好?
在大數(shù)據(jù)時代,互聯(lián)網(wǎng)已成為標配,很多企業(yè)為了發(fā)展都紛紛想向互聯(lián)網(wǎng)+轉型。但大家都面臨一個問題,有一個好的軟件想法或者方案,卻沒有可實施的技術人員。
很多初次創(chuàng)業(yè)或不了解互聯(lián)網(wǎng)軟件的人不知道應該自己組建一個技術團隊開發(fā),還是尋找一家合適的APP外包公司。
其實二者都需要從多方面去考量,喜妹今天就客觀的來給大家分析一波~
自建團隊
優(yōu)勢
1.同一辦公場地,更放心更及時
自己組建開發(fā)技術團隊,所有人員都是自己面試篩選的,在技術和為人方面更加放心。
在同一間辦公室里工作,對技術人員的工作態(tài)度、工作進度和工作質量都可以進行觀察和監(jiān)督,更容易把控。還可以隨時進行面對面交流,如果發(fā)現(xiàn)問題,能及時討論和解決。
因為都是公司的一份子,也是做公司自己的產品,大家更能心往一處想,力往一處使。如果產品涉及到公司內部的商業(yè)機密,保密性也更有保障。
2.需求調整更靈活、考慮更周全
互聯(lián)網(wǎng)的快速發(fā)展使得市場常常會有變動,產品也需要跟隨著市場的變動而變化。
如果在產品設計和開發(fā)階段中想調整或增加需求,自建團隊可以隨時進行修改。
對于自建團隊來說,設計和開發(fā)過程相當于是實踐性的操作,為產品的功能和流程多了更多思考、調整的時間,可以更充分更純粹的去考慮產品本身的合理性和用戶體驗感,提升了調整和優(yōu)化的靈活度。
3.問題響應快、運營維護更快捷
自建技術團隊在產品實際運營過程中,能更快的對產生的BUG和問題進行響應,可以在更短的時間內討論出解決方案并執(zhí)行。
為了迎合市場變動,根據(jù)產品的后期運營情況,自建團隊能更快進行產品的內容更新和迭代升級,包括產品開發(fā)完成后的維護或二次開發(fā)也能更加方便快捷。
缺點
1.時間長
①招人
自建開發(fā)團隊需要招聘產品經(jīng)理、UI設計師、ios工程師、安卓工程師、后臺工程師、測試工程師,如果要做小程序的話,還需要招一個H5。這么多關鍵性的技術人才也不是短時間能招到的,畢竟還得招合適的、技術好的、有經(jīng)驗的,甚至能帶團隊的。
假如你的公司不是一個技術型公司,那招人的時間會被拉得更長,畢竟對于有工作經(jīng)驗的工程師,薪水高、平臺大、待遇好、穩(wěn)定的大公司才是他們的首選。
②磨合
畢竟軟件開發(fā)是一個團隊協(xié)作的結果,自建團隊的人員從組建齊到熟悉業(yè)務再互相磨合需要一段時間,大家剛入職也不熟悉,溝通可能會不太順暢。
大家也都知道產品經(jīng)理和程序員“不和”,幾乎都是做自家公司的產品會出現(xiàn)的問題。比如對待產品的需求變更,雙方往往會有不同的態(tài)度和意見,就很容易產生矛盾和摩擦。
③開發(fā)周期
自建團隊的產品開發(fā)周期是無法確定的,一方面是員工不穩(wěn)定,如果其中有人離職就又得重新招人、重新磨合;另一方面是光憑面試可能了解不到程序員的真實水平,假如在開發(fā)過程中遇到某些技術難點,或是出現(xiàn)很多bug,就又得花更多的時間去解決處理。
當然還有產品需求的不斷修改、調整,和行業(yè)經(jīng)驗不足等因素,也會耽誤很多開發(fā)時間。
2.成本高
①工資成本
一款產品至少需要1個產品經(jīng)理、1個UI設計師、1個ios工程師、1個安卓工程師、1個后臺工程師、1個測試工程師,我們就先不算做小程序的1個H5工程師,所以自建一個開發(fā)團隊至少需要招聘6個人。
因每個城市不同,薪資水平也會有所差異。我們先以成都的平均薪資為例,一個有3年工作經(jīng)驗的工程師的月工資為12000。
對于一個6人的開發(fā)團隊,每月的員工工資成本至少為70000,加上員工福利、五險一金、設備、房租等費用,一個月的成本至少為90000。
而一款產品從需求梳理到產品成型再到上線,對于臨時自建的開發(fā)團隊而言至少需要三個月的時間,則這三個月的工資成本至少是27萬。
②維護成本
在APP開發(fā)完成和上線后,產品開始正常運營的階段時,程序員只需要做好日常的維護,遇到問題及時修復就好了。如果不會在運營過程中頻繁調整、增加新的功能,那產品經(jīng)理、UI設計師、測試工程師幾乎都沒有太多工作了。
那這個時候公司是繼續(xù)養(yǎng)著一群高薪的技術“閑人”?還是解雇一部分呢?這些問題值得深思。
找外包公司
優(yōu)勢
1.專業(yè)有經(jīng)驗
專業(yè)的事交給專業(yè)的人做,這就是APP外包公司出現(xiàn)的原因。
靠譜的APP外包公司都擁有多年的開發(fā)經(jīng)驗,開發(fā)團隊的技術也是經(jīng)過了實踐的驗證,開發(fā)出來的軟件質量是有保障的。
App外包公司會遇到過各行各業(yè)的客戶,開發(fā)過各式各樣的軟件,有很多成熟的框架。對于每個行業(yè)的運營邏輯和商業(yè)模式都有一定的了解,能更好的幫你完善產品的思路和流程。
有的APP外包公司還為客戶提供行業(yè)領域專業(yè)的解決方案(比如喜望軟件),這比你自建團隊去盲目開發(fā)好太多了。
2.省時省力省心
靠譜的APP外包公司在互聯(lián)網(wǎng)行業(yè)深耕了很多年,公司運營和管理方面都更穩(wěn)定,各開發(fā)人員之間都很熟悉,節(jié)省了磨合時間。
因為有經(jīng)驗,不管是產品經(jīng)理還是開發(fā)工程師都能很快上手,測試工程師也能在軟件測試時有更明確的側重點和注意點。
你如果找了一家靠譜的APP外包公司,只需要在前期把需求溝通到位、原型UI確認清楚、開發(fā)測試過程中跟蹤好節(jié)點就行了,比自建團隊更省心。
3.低成本試錯
很多人做軟件還是人生中的第一次,找APP外包公司可以用更低的成本來試錯,去觀察創(chuàng)業(yè)方向和行業(yè)風向。
這個低成本除了上述幾點原因,還有就是APP外包公司一般都會有成熟的成品軟件,即改即用,上線速度快,比APP定制開發(fā)投入更低。
在前期做個最壞的打算,假如這個產品做出來之后運營不起來,或者因為別的什么原因失敗了,如果這時想放棄,你不需要去支付自建團隊的解散違約金。
缺點
1.靠譜的APP外包公司不好找
首先聲明,上述的APP外包公司的優(yōu)勢只針對靠譜的。
市面上APP外包公司很多,技術、報價和服務參差不齊,很難選擇。(畢竟關于APP外包公司的坑,很多人都深有體會)
2.靈活度不高
如果選擇APP外包公司進行合作,在需求溝通確認完成后是需要簽訂開發(fā)合同的,不管是功能、流程、價格都會在那時定下來,不能像自建團隊一樣隨時根據(jù)業(yè)務發(fā)展做出修改。
在產品設計階段,如果是很小的需求調整,有些APP外包公司是會免費幫您調整的;但如果是大變動,就需要再重新簽訂補充協(xié)議,支付對應功能的新增費用。
但如果已經(jīng)進入開發(fā)階段,一般是不接受需求變更的。畢竟需求一變,原型和UI都要重新設計,再進入開發(fā),既耽誤開發(fā)時間,也會增加成本。
軟件開發(fā)外包怎么樣?
移動互聯(lián)網(wǎng)時代,各企業(yè)都在加緊的布局移動端,無論是通過是app應用還是時下最為火熱的小程序。關于找軟件外包公司開發(fā)App軟件或是小程序開發(fā),優(yōu)匠科技作為軟件開發(fā)商,給各企業(yè)說說以下3點注意事項,希望對于想要開發(fā)app或是小程序的企業(yè)有一定的幫助!
一、注重前期的需求的分析和溝通
企業(yè)開發(fā)app或是小程序最終的目的是獲取用戶并攫取用戶的價值。想要實現(xiàn)這個目的,前提是用戶喜歡并長期使用企業(yè)的app或是小程序,想要滿足這個條件,那么企業(yè)的app或是小程序必須要很好的滿足用戶的需求才行,所以對于用戶的需求分析是重中之重。
二、不要一味的注重價格
市面上的確有很多幾百幾千的小程序或是幾千上萬的app軟件,但是試想一下這樣的軟件真的能夠為企業(yè)帶來用戶并能長期留住用戶嗎?因為正常的軟件開發(fā)的成本是不可能這么低的。企業(yè)是以盈利為目的的,不可能虧本做生意,那么市面是的幾千塊的軟件質量可想而知了。
三、售后服務不能輕視
只要是軟件就不可能完全避免系統(tǒng)發(fā)生問題或是有bug的情況。所以在選擇開發(fā)商的時候,一定要注重看一下開發(fā)商的售后服務怎樣??赡苡腥藭f,軟件都還沒有開發(fā)出來,怎么能知道開發(fā)商的售后服務質量怎樣呢!一般正規(guī)的具有一定規(guī)模的開發(fā)商售后的服務還是比較完善。
以上就是優(yōu)匠科技給出的關于企業(yè)開發(fā)軟件時需要注意的一些事項,總的來說呢,企業(yè)應要十分注重與開發(fā)商關于功能需求的溝通確認,還有就是在選擇開發(fā)商這件事上不應一味的注重價格,而是需要綜合考量,再者就是要多關注一下開發(fā)商的售后服務,為以后的運營推廣在一定程度上免除后顧之憂。
企業(yè)進行軟件開發(fā)可以選擇自主招人開發(fā),也是可以選擇軟件公司開發(fā)的,那么企業(yè)軟件外包開發(fā)好嗎,對于中小企業(yè)來說還是可以的,我們公司就是可以開發(fā)的,下面來為大家介紹下企業(yè)軟件外包開發(fā)有什么好處。
1、軟件外包公司在一定程度上為企業(yè)節(jié)省了開發(fā)成本,相對于企業(yè)自己組建團隊做一個軟件開發(fā)部門所投入的時間、資金成本來說,將APP軟件開發(fā)項目承包給開發(fā)公司所投入的成本費用要低的多。
2、軟件外包公司可以提高更加專業(yè)的服務,市場上各種APP軟件層出不窮,計算機所涉及的專業(yè)知識范圍相當廣泛,企業(yè)的需求也是多種多樣,僅僅幾個技術人員是無法完全掌握技術知識的,而外包公司配備的人員齊全。
3、企業(yè)自建團隊需要一定時間相互溝通、了解,需要時間磨合培養(yǎng)默契,相關的主要領導和員工也需要對企業(yè)網(wǎng)絡系統(tǒng)有足夠的認識才能滿足需要。而外包公司不需要,可以立即實施。
4、企業(yè)與軟件外包公司合作可以克服企業(yè)自身的技術人員的局限性,以及企業(yè)人員流動影響穩(wěn)定性帶來的負面影響,后期開發(fā)公司還可以為企業(yè)提供一定的技術支持,在一定時間內負責軟件的維護工作。
關于軟件開發(fā)外包好不好和開發(fā)軟件的外包公司有哪些的介紹到此就結束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關注本站。